Bagikan melalui


Fungsi ConvertInterfaceLuidToIndex (netioapi.h)

Fungsi ConvertInterfaceLuidToIndex mengonversi pengidentifikasi unik lokal (LUID) untuk antarmuka jaringan ke indeks lokal untuk antarmuka.

Sintaks

IPHLPAPI_DLL_LINKAGE _NETIOAPI_SUCCESS_ NETIOAPI_API ConvertInterfaceLuidToIndex(
  [in]  const NET_LUID *InterfaceLuid,
  [out] PNET_IFINDEX   InterfaceIndex
);

Parameter

[in] InterfaceLuid

Pointer ke NET_LUID untuk antarmuka jaringan.

[out] InterfaceIndex

Nilai indeks lokal untuk antarmuka.

Nilai kembali

Setelah berhasil, ConvertInterfaceLuidToIndex mengembalikan NO_ERROR. Setiap nilai pengembalian bukan nol menunjukkan kegagalan dan NET_IFINDEX_UNSPECIFIED dikembalikan dalam parameter InterfaceIndex .

Kode kesalahan Makna
ERROR_INVALID_PARAMETER
Salah satu parameter tidak valid. Kesalahan ini dikembalikan jika parameter InterfaceLuid atau InterfaceIndexadalah NULL atau jika parameter InterfaceLuid tidak valid.

Keterangan

Fungsi ConvertInterfaceLuidToIndex tersedia di Windows Vista dan yang lebih baru.

Fungsi ConvertInterfaceLuidToIndex adalah protokol independen dan bekerja dengan antarmuka jaringan untuk protokol IPv6 dan IPv4.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ows Vista [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2008 [hanya aplikasi desktop]
Target Platform Windows
Header netioapi.h (termasuk Iphlpapi.h)
Pustaka Iphlpapi.lib
DLL Iphlpapi.dll

Lihat juga

ConvertInterfaceAliasToLuid

ConvertInterfaceGuidToLuid

ConvertInterfaceIndexToLuid

ConvertInterfaceLuidToAlias

ConvertInterfaceLuidToGuid

ConvertInterfaceLuidToNameA

ConvertInterfaceLuidToNameW

ConvertInterfaceNameToLuidA

ConvertInterfaceNameToLuidW

NET_LUID

if_indextoname

if_nametoindex